﻿@import url("common.css");

#pageleft #icontact {width:190px; margin:20px 15px; background:url(../images/leftewm.jpg) top no-repeat; padding-top:200px; line-height:28px; font-size:12px; color:#fff;}


/* qqshop focus */
#banner {width:980px; margin:0 auto 10px auto;}
#banner #focus {width:980px; height:370px; margin:0; overflow:hidden; position:relative;}
#banner #focus ul {height:370px; position:absolute;}
#banner #focus ul li {float:left; width:980px; height:370px; overflow:hidden; position:relative; background:#000;}
#banner #focus ul li div {position:absolute; overflow:hidden;}
#banner #focus ul li img {width:980px; height:370px;}
#banner #focus .btnBg {position:absolute; width:980px; height:20px; left:0; bottom:0;}
#banner #focus .btn { position:absolute; height:10px; padding:5px 10px; bottom:0; margin-left:0; width:950px; margin-bottom:10px; text-align:right;}
#banner #focus .btn span {display:inline-block; _display:inline; _zoom:1; width:55px; height:8px; _font-size:0; margin-left:5px; cursor:pointer; background:#fff;}
#banner #focus .btn span.on {background:#007dcd;}
#banner #focus .preNext {width:45px; height:100px; position:absolute; top:90px; cursor:pointer;}
#banner #focus .pre {left:0;}
#banner #focus .next {right:0; background-position:right top;}

.ibar {height:24px; margin-bottom:10px;}
.ibar .more {float:right;}
.ibar .more img {margin-top:3px;}
.ibar span {color:#007ecb; font-size:16px; border-left:2px solid #007ecb; padding-left:15px;}
.ibar span font {font-size:13px; color:#676767;}

#iabout {width:330px; height:240px; margin-left:15px; float:left; background:url(../images/bg_itopspec.jpg) right no-repeat; padding-right:15px; margin-right:10px;}
#iabout #aboutbody {line-height:24px;}
#iabout #aboutbody img {float:left; margin-right:10px;}
#inews {width:345px; height:240px; float:left; background:url(../images/bg_itopspec.jpg) right no-repeat; padding-right:15px;}
#inews dl {margin:0;}
#inews dl dt {height:98px; line-height:22px;}
#inews dl dt h3 {margin-bottom:5px;}
#inews dl dt h3 a {color:#000;}
#inews dl dt img {float:left; margin-right:10px;}
#inews dl dd {border-bottom:1px dashed #CCC; height:29px; line-height:29px;}
#inews dl dd span {float:right; color:#999;}
#icase {width:240px; height:240px; float:right;}

#iproduct {margin-left:15px; margin-bottom:10px;}
#iproduct #colee_left table tr td img {margin:0 5px; padding:1px; border:2px solid #D4D4D4;-moz-border-radius: 3px; -webkit-border-radius: 3px; border-radius:3px;}

#iknowledge {height:140px; width:355px; float:left; margin-left:15px; overflow:hidden;}
#iknowledge dl {position:relative; padding-left:60px;}
#iknowledge dl dt {width:14px; left:0; top:0; padding:34px 28px 34px 18px; background:url(../images/ibar5.jpg) left no-repeat; font-size:14px; line-height:18px; height:72px; position:absolute; overflow:hidden;}
#iknowledge dl dd {height:27px; line-height:27px; text-align:left; width:280px; border-bottom:1px dashed #CCC; background:url(../images/ico_ibli.jpg) left no-repeat; padding-left:15px;}
#iknowledge dl dd span {float:right; color:#999;}

#ilastcase {height:140px; width:335px; float:left; margin-left:15px; overflow:hidden;}
#ilastcase dl {position:relative; padding-left:60px;}
#ilastcase dl dt {width:14px; left:0; top:0; padding:34px 29px 34px 17px; background:url(../images/ibar5.jpg) left no-repeat; font-size:14px; line-height:18px; height:72px; position:absolute; overflow:hidden;}
#ilastcase dl dd {height:27px; line-height:27px; text-align:left; width:260px; border-bottom:1px dashed #CCC; background:url(../images/ico_ibli.jpg) left no-repeat; padding-left:15px;}
#ilastcase dl dd span {float:right; color:#999;}

#iquick {width:238px; float:right; height:140px; overflow:hidden;}
#iquick ul li {margin-bottom:8px;}